The formula we use is: length * 2 + 12. It turns out we > underestimate the memory usage for string. Here is a list of real memory > footprint for string we get from memory dump: > | length of string | memory in bytes | > | 7 | 56 | > | 3 | 48 | > | 1 | 40 | > I did a search and find the following formula can accurately estimate the > memory footprint for string: > {code} > 8 * (int) (((length * 2) + 45) / 8) > {code} -- This message is automatically generated by JIRA. - You can reply to this email to add a comment to the issue online.
